基于随机森林的数控机床代码类型识别与异常检测方法

    公开(公告)号:CN116088420B

    公开(公告)日:2024-09-17

    申请号:CN202211575175.6

    申请日:2022-12-08

    Abstract: 本发明公开了一种基于随机森林的数控机床代码类型识别与异常检测方法,所述方法如下:S1:根据数控机床的编程手册制定指令关键字功能表;S2:对NC代码的语法规则进行统计,形成语法规则库;S3:根据NC代码的语法规则库和指令关键字功能表内容对NC代码进行特征提取;S4:将关键字特征和语法特征构造成特征值矩阵,训练随机森林分类器;S5:将未知类型NC代码进行预处理与词法语法检查;S6:将未知类型NC代码进行特征处理,建立特征值矩阵,输入S4训练好的随机森林分类器中,对NC代码进行识别。本发明能够对NC代码所属的类型进行识别与检测,不仅能提升企业对数控程序的管理效率,还能降低NC代码引用错误发生的概率。

    一种工业机器人安全评价指标构建方法

    公开(公告)号:CN114418269A

    公开(公告)日:2022-04-29

    申请号:CN202111443835.0

    申请日:2021-11-30

    Abstract: 本发明公开了一种工业机器人安全评价指标构建方法,所述方法如下:S1:确定待测工业机器人系统内识别的风险数量,选取安全评价指标集;S2:通过专家评分对每一个风险的各安全评价指标进行安全评分,形成原始评价矩阵;S3:采用主成分聚类方法计算特征值、贡献率,确定工业机器人综合安全指标数量;S4:计算各安全指标在综合安全指标的载荷,对安全指标聚类;S5:判定各风险在安全评价指标评价结果下的评价等级,计算安全指标权重;S6:根据安全指标权重阈值筛选出影响度大的安全评价指标,构建工业机器人安全评价指标体系。该方法可对工业机器人系统风险评估的众多评价指标进行筛选分类,构建合适的工业机器人系统安全评价指标体系。

    一种基于压力感知的室内定位装置及方法

    公开(公告)号:CN114234980A

    公开(公告)日:2022-03-25

    申请号:CN202111547637.9

    申请日:2021-12-16

    Abstract: 本发明公开了一种基于压力感知的室内定位装置及方法,所述室内定位装置包括定位单元、AD转换芯片、无线通信模块、中央处理器,其中:所述定位单元包括感压定位地板和压力传感器,感压定位地板左上、左下、右上、右下角的外部分别设置一个压力传感器;所述压力传感器输出的压力信号经过AD转换芯片转换后变为可以进行运算的压力数据,发送到定位区域的中央处理器,中央处理器计算得出受力点坐标,通过无线通信模块发送到上位机显示当前压力施加的具体位置。本发明对现有文献的基于压力感知的定位硬件布置进行改进优化,降低了室内定位所需的传感器数量,提高了压力数据的使用率,增加了压力感知定位系统的可扩展性。

    一种基于脆弱水印的NC代码完整性异常检测方法

    公开(公告)号:CN119720136A

    公开(公告)日:2025-03-28

    申请号:CN202411761783.5

    申请日:2024-12-03

    Abstract: 本发明公开了一种基于脆弱水印的NC代码完整性异常检测方法,所述方法首先,通过分析刀具轨迹的几何特征,结合代码中的G代码、M代码等指令信息,采用特征点检测算法识别出转角较大或几何变化显著的区域作为水印嵌入的关键位置;然后,生成唯一的水印信息并将其嵌入到选定的冗余坐标点中,确保不影响刀具轨迹的几何形状;接着,传输完成后,通过水印提取技术从嵌入点恢复水印信息,并将其保存以便后续比对;最后,通过比对提取的水印与原始水印,检测是否发生篡改,如有异常则定位篡改位置并停止加工操作,确保安全。本发明通过脆弱水印技术实现了对NC代码的高度灵敏检测,能够对任何篡改做出精确的判断,确保代码的完整性和安全性。

    一种基于压力感知的室内定位装置及方法

    公开(公告)号:CN114234980B

    公开(公告)日:2023-11-10

    申请号:CN202111547637.9

    申请日:2021-12-16

    Abstract: 本发明公开了一种基于压力感知的室内定位装置及方法,所述室内定位装置包括定位单元、AD转换芯片、无线通信模块、中央处理器,其中:所述定位单元包括感压定位地板和压力传感器,感压定位地板左上、左下、右上、右下角的外部分别设置一个压力传感器;所述压力传感器输出的压力信号经过AD转换芯片转换后变为可以进行运算的压力数据,发送到定位区域的中央处理器,中央处理器计算得出受力点坐标,通过无线通信模块发送到上位机显示当前压力施加的具体位置。本发明对现有文献的基于压力感知的定位硬件布置进行改进优化,降低了室内定位所需的传感器数量,提高了压力数据的使用率,增加了压力感知定位系统的可扩展性。

    基于随机森林的数控机床代码类型识别与异常检测方法

    公开(公告)号:CN116088420A

    公开(公告)日:2023-05-09

    申请号:CN202211575175.6

    申请日:2022-12-08

    Abstract: 本发明公开了一种基于随机森林的数控机床代码类型识别与异常检测方法,所述方法如下:S1:根据数控机床的编程手册制定指令关键字功能表;S2:对NC代码的语法规则进行统计,形成语法规则库;S3:根据NC代码的语法规则库和指令关键字功能表内容对NC代码进行特征提取;S4:将关键字特征和语法特征构造成特征值矩阵,训练随机森林分类器;S5:将未知类型NC代码进行预处理与词法语法检查;S6:将未知类型NC代码进行特征处理,建立特征值矩阵,输入S4训练好的随机森林分类器中,对NC代码进行识别。本发明能够对NC代码所属的类型进行识别与检测,不仅能提升企业对数控程序的管理效率,还能降低NC代码引用错误发生的概率。

Patent Agency Ranking